      Equally good, diametrically opposed aesthetically. Lomachenko's my favourite fighter to watch because he's always in motion. Rigo's my least because it looks like he never is. Same talent level, complete opposites in dynamism.

        I'll say Rigo simply because his works defensively, and Loma loses a lot of power because he's so light on his feet. Rigo's movement is more subtle but if you see what he's doing, it's really brilliant. Both guys are at the top of the sport in footwork so it's not like one is vastly better than the other in that regard.
